Functional ecology and sustainable management of the Munessa forest, Ethiopia - Central project and coordinating scientist

The project package "Functional ecology and sustainable management of the Munessa forest, Ethiopia" aims at generating and analysing variables that govern the functioning of a mountain forest ecosystem in Ethiopia. The findings are expected to lay strong scientific bases for the sustainable management of Ethiopian forests. The studies are based at experimental sites located close to a field station constructed with the financial supports of DFG and DFG/BMZ in the previous project phase. In the coming project phase, the silvicultural experiments are foreseen to serve as a nucleus for the different scientific disciplines. The enlargement of the project in the upcoming phase needs a more robust coordination of the administrative and scientific works and Project Package Munessa Forest, Ethiopia - Central Project and Coordinating Scientist collaboration among the participating scientists, which requires the employment of a project coordinating scientist. His tasks are: 1) to coordinate the fieldwork, 2) to administer the project car and the field station, 3) to manage plots established for scientific work, 4) to update Ethiopian foresters on the findings of the project by organising training seminars, 5) to liaison the German researchers with their Ethiopian partners, 6) to strengthen inter and intra-networking (e.g. with regular newsletter and updating the project website), and 7) to lead the preparation of a manual for the sustainable management of the Munessa forest. This proposal also includes activities and costs that are indispensable for running the project package successfully. Such activities include administration of the field station, running of the project car as well as the effective management of the silvicultural experimental plots, which are central for the whole package.
